From the gait analysis it is decided whether or not you would benefit from the prescription of custom made orthotics.

At Sports Feet we use a technique that is used nowhere else in Australia to produce custom made orthotics.

The traditional way of making orthotics is to cast the foot in plaster while sitting or lying prone, in other words in a non weight bearing position. At sports feet our orthotics are heat molded to your feet in a more natural weight-bearing stance.

During the heat molding stage your feet and lower limbs are positioned so as to correct abnormal biomechanics and to ensure good lower limb alignment.


Step one

You stand on the high definition silicon bags, whilst your feet are manipulated into a neutral position. An exact imprint of you feet is formed.

Step two

The orthotics are heated under pressure and any additional support required is added.

Step three

The heated orthotics are place into your foot print whilst you stand on them (in a neutral position), until the orthotics hardens.

Step four

Final adjustments are made, and your orthotics are inserted into your shoes ready to be used! It must be noted that if extra support is required this process may take several days.
